Repository containing Netsquid simulator of balloon-based quantum networks including downlink, uplink and horizontal free-space channels.
The article assosciated to this repository can be currently found on arXiv, under the name Free-space model for balloon-based quantum networks (arXiv:2412.03356).

balloon_qnet
uses the NetSquid Python package. To install and use NetSquid, you need to first create an account.
Please take note that NetSquid only supports Linux and MacOS. For Windows users it is recommended to either use a virtual machine or use Windows Subsystem for Linux (WSL).
To run these function the following has to be installed:
- Python version 3.9 at most
- Netsquid, Quantum Network simulation tool, https://netsquid.org/
- Lowtran from https://github.com/francescopiccia/lowtran-piccia
